UH Track Finishes First Day Of Mt. SAC Relays

WALNUT, Calif. - The Hawai`i women's track and field team competed at the prestigious Mt. SAC Relays, Thursday, at Hilmer Lodge Stadium on the campus of Mt. San Antonio College. The Rainbow Wahine were not at full strength as a virus struck the team overnight and forced one athlete to drop out of her event.

In addition, sophomore Annett Wichmann, who was leading after day one of the California Invitational Multi-Events heptathlon, was forced to withdraw.

One day after qualifying for the NCAA Regionals in the pole vault at the Cal State Los Angeles Twilight Open, sophomore Patricia Gauthier made standard again with a jump of 12-5.5 to finish in a tie for third. Junior Tiara Krismunando matched her personal best with a jump of 11-11.75, which tied for ninth. Freshman Samantha Weaver had a new season best jump of 11-5.75 while freshman Jessica Trujillo also cleared 11-5.75.

In the discus, freshman Nicole Awaa finished in 13th place with a throw of 137-7 while sophomore Meghan Weaver took 18th after her heave of 136-2.

In the 1500m, sophomore Chantelle Laan clocked in at 4:42.00 to finish in 28th place.

The Mt. SAC Relays continues on Friday. Some members of the Rainbow Wahine will also compete at the Pomona-Pitzer Invitational on Friday.
